Technical Field
[0001] This invention relates to the field of aero-engine technology, and specifically to an aero-engine rotor connection device and method. Background Technology
[0002] The rotor is a core component of an aero-engine, and its assembly quality is crucial to the engine's performance. Because aero-engine rotors operate in environments characterized by high temperature, high pressure, and high speed, problems such as excessive concentricity deviations and uneven bolt preload in rotor assembly directly impact the overall engine's performance parameters and operating efficiency.
[0003] Aero-engine rotor assemblies are often composed of multiple disk-like parts. The connection structure between rotor stages is in the form of "stop-bolt," and the connection process includes stop fitting and bolt tightening. The stop fitting is an interference fit, which achieves the centering function of the rotor. Stop fitting is often performed by temperature difference method (hot fitting / cold fitting). However, because the stop fitting surface of the rotor will deform under temperature changes, manual assembly of the stop fitting will result in insufficient contact of the stop fitting surface due to deformation, thus causing deviation in the coaxiality of the rotor assembly. Bolt tightening achieves the axial tension effect on the rotor, but due to the compact internal structure of the rotor and the inaccessibility by visual inspection, manual tightening is inefficient and results in poor assembly quality. Summary of the Invention
[0004] In view of the above problems, the present invention provides an aero-engine rotor connection device and method, which solves the problem of low efficiency of manual operation in the connection process of aero-engine rotors in the prior art, and improves the assembly efficiency and assembly quality of aero-engine rotors.

[0049] On the other hand, the present invention provides a method for connecting an aircraft engine rotor device, using the aforementioned aircraft engine rotor connection device, comprising the following specific steps:
[0050] Step 1: Connect the first and second stage disk assembly 51 of the rotor to the rotor positioning device 3. The lower end face of the first and second stage disk assembly 51 is connected to the upper end face of the rotor support platform 34. The first and second stage disk assembly 51 is locked by the limiting mechanism 32 driven by the rotor positioning motor 33, and the first and second stage disk assembly 51 is fixedly connected to the rotor positioning device 3.
[0051] Step 2: Connect the rotor third-stage disk 52 to the upper second-stage disk of the first and second-stage disk assembly, and apply clamping force through the first clamping device 4 to clamp it, so as to achieve an interference fit between the second and third-stage disks of the rotor 5.
[0052] Step 3: Connect the upper end face of the rotor drum 53 to the adapter 6, and connect the adapter 6 to the lifting device 7. Apply downward pressure through the lifting device 7 to connect the rotor drum 53 to the upper part of the three-stage disc 52 to obtain the rotor after clamping and installation. Move the rotor after clamping and installation to the lower part of the second clamping device 12 through the transfer guide rail 2.
[0053] Step 4: Use the second clamping device 12 to apply clamping force to the transfer fixture 6 on the upper end face of the drum 53 of the rotor after clamping and installation, so as to achieve an interference fit between the drum 53 and the three-stage disc 52.
[0054] Step 5: Drive the tightening device 13 to descend, and the tightening arm 134 unfolds in the blind cavity of the rotor after it has been pressed and installed, tightening the corresponding nuts on the three-stage disc 52, thus completing the bolt tightening inside the rotor 5.
[0055] Preferably, step three includes the following specific steps:
[0056] The upper end face of the rotor drum 53 is connected to the adapter 62. The adapter 6 is installed on the adapter and connected to the lifting device 7. The rotor drum 53 is connected to the upper part of the three-stage disc 52 through the lifting device.
[0057] The locking pin 63 is passed through the operating hole 621. The two connecting pins 632 of the locking pin 63 are inserted from bottom to top through the mounting hole of the drum 53 and then through the pin hole of the adapter 62. Then, the locking disc 64 is rotated by the rotating shaft 66 so that the edge of the locking disc 64 is inserted into the locking groove 633 of the locking pin 63, realizing the engagement of the locking disc 64 and the locking pin 63. Then, the handle 67 is rotated to tighten the connection between the locking pin 63 and the locking disc 64, thereby locking the adapter 6 onto the drum 53.
[0058] After obtaining the clamped rotor, move the clamped rotor to the underside of the second clamping device 12 via the transfer guide rail 2.
[0059] Compared with the prior art, the present invention has at least the following beneficial effects:
[0060] (1) The present invention integrates the stop clamping device and the bolt tightening device in the rotor connection process, which can complete the bolt tightening at the same time as clamping, thereby improving the rotor connection efficiency and assembly quality.
[0061] (2) The stop clamping device of the present invention can clamp each rotor stop connection separately, and can precisely control the clamping force during the clamping process, thus ensuring the stability of the clamping effect;
[0062] (3) The bolt tightening device of the present invention has the functions of automation and visualization, which overcomes the limitations of manual operation due to the narrow blind cavity space inside the rotor, and improves tightening efficiency and accuracy.
[0063] (4) The present invention does not require additional lifting equipment for the hoisting of the rotor and tightening device, which saves costs and improves the working efficiency of the assembly line. Attached Figure Description
